Looking for a different way to "carry" in my new truck. My old truck had a divider in the console that make it easy to store a pistol but my new one is just one big hole to throw things. Besides lifting the lid being a pain I don't want to have to search in a pile of stuff if it is needed. So how do you "carry" in your vehicle?

Originally Posted by FiremanJG
7.5" AR pistol

Muzzle down, grip an mag jammed between the console and passenger seat.



Most likely that is not legal. Makes no sense but a pistol carried in a vehicle must either be concealed or in a holster. It’s not legal to have a pistol just laying in your seat or visible in any way unless it is in a holster.
